平面多边形面积问题
提起平面多边形,最容易想到的就是三角形了。对于简单的三角形面积问题大家一定不陌生!其中就编程而言,精确度最高的当属通过叉积(也称内积)来求解。那么是不是平面多边形也可以通过将多边形分割成一个个的三角形进而求解呢?
回答是肯定的,以梯形ABCD为例,S梯形ABCD=S三角形ABC+S三角形ACD 。
同样对于多边形来说我们也可以通过同样的分割三角形法来实现多边形面积的求解。但是,我们需要做一下排
本文介绍了如何通过将平面多边形分割为多个三角形并利用叉积来求解其面积。首先,需要对多边形的顶点进行逆时针排序,然后通过计算相邻顶点之间的叉积累加得到多边形的总面积。提供了一个具体的算法实现,并给出了相关题目链接供练习。
平面多边形面积问题
提起平面多边形,最容易想到的就是三角形了。对于简单的三角形面积问题大家一定不陌生!其中就编程而言,精确度最高的当属通过叉积(也称内积)来求解。那么是不是平面多边形也可以通过将多边形分割成一个个的三角形进而求解呢?
回答是肯定的,以梯形ABCD为例,S梯形ABCD=S三角形ABC+S三角形ACD 。
同样对于多边形来说我们也可以通过同样的分割三角形法来实现多边形面积的求解。但是,我们需要做一下排

被折叠的 条评论
为什么被折叠?